**Ticket: Signature check failing on schema publish — Veldrome registry**

Heads up for whoever touches this next: publishes to the Veldrome event schema registry started bouncing with SIG_MISMATCH after Tuesday's cutover. Turns out the CI runner was still verifying against the retired Q2 key while producers signed with the new one. We patched the pipeline, but the fix only sticks if the verifier config carries the current key. For reference, the key the registry now trusts is below.

rollout seal: bky4_yke3

## Dark Mode in the Quillden Admin

Plugin authors should never hardcode colors. The Quillden shell injects theme tokens at load, and your panel must consume them via the provided style variables. Panels that fail the contrast check are flagged in review and won't be listed. Token names, the theme-switch event, and a testing checklist are documented on the internal page below.

wiki page, hahif-hahif: https://argocd.kelvisys.corp/browse/board/settings/pages/1442e0b1065d83f1

# Break-Glass Access: Wavecrumb Preview Service

The Wavecrumb service renders audio waveform previews for the Tidemark editor. Under normal operation, maintainers never need production access; rendering is fully automated. If the preview queue wedges and on-call cannot reach the job runner through standard tooling, break-glass access to the render host is permitted. File an incident first, then notify the platform lead within one hour. The break-glass account unlocks with the recovery passphrase recorded below.

unlock words, yagep-fahof: belix-rusvan-casdor-gorox-aldath-norael-istix-quenael-fraeth-silael